Rui Vilar is affiliated with Instituto Superior Técnico in Portugal and has a multidisciplinary research profile spanning medicine and engineering. Their work particularly focuses on areas intersecting blood properties, coagulation, and advanced material processing techniques.

Among Rui Vilar's published research are several papers covering topics in hematology and biomedical engineering. Notable publications include:

  • "Fibrin(ogen) in human disease: both friend and foe," 2020, Haematologica
  • "A Novel Nonsense Mutation in FGB (c.1421G>A; p.Trp474Ter) in the Beta Chain of Fibrinogen Causing Hypofibrinogenemia with Bleeding Phenotype," 2020, Biomedicines
  • "Perioperative management of a severe congenital hypofibrinogenemia with thrombotic phenotype," 2020, Thrombosis Research
  • "Relationship between microstructure, phase transformation, and mechanical behavior in Ti-40Ta alloys for biomedical applications," 2021, Journal of Materials Research and Technology
  • "Femtosecond laser micromachining of carbon fiber-reinforced epoxy matrix composites," 2022, Journal of Manufacturing Processes
